如果日程数量庞大,且需要频繁的插入和删除操作,std::list 或 std::set 更合适。
mkdir ~/tmp 设置 TMPDIR 环境变量: 将 TMPDIR 环境变量设置为你创建的临时目录。
\n";<br> }<br> return 0;<br> } 如果example.txt原本有内容,新行会加在最后;如果没有,会创建新文件并写入。
问题分析:为何直接文本解码会失败?
调用频率:频繁传递大型值类型参数会导致大量内存复制。
PrecisionScale() (int64, int64, bool): 如果列类型有精度和刻度(如 DECIMAL(10,2)),则返回它们。
这个过程涉及获取服务账户凭证、将P12私钥转换为PEM格式,并编写Go代码利用goauth2/oauth/jwt库获取访问令牌。
编译器会在不同平台上自动定义特定的宏,我们可以依据这些宏进行条件编译或运行时判断。
我通常会这样来思考和实践: 1. 请求验证错误 (RequestValidationError) 千面视频动捕 千面视频动捕是一个AI视频动捕解决方案,专注于将视频中的人体关节二维信息转化为三维模型动作。
arsort():按数组的值进行降序排列,同样保留键值关联。
func Main() { for f := range mainfunc { // 修正了原始答案中的f = range mainfunc 语法错误 f() } } // do函数:将一个函数f提交到mainfunc通道,并在主线程执行完毕后等待其完成。
纯文本上下文 (Plain Text):比如命令行输出、日志文件、CSV文件等。
在C++中格式化输出字符串,有多种方式可以实现,每种方法各有特点,适用于不同场景。
使用testing包进行专业基准测试 testing包提供了一套强大的基准测试框架,能够自动管理测试运行次数、计时和报告结果。
很多时候,项目初期我们并不需要极致的性能,更看重开发速度和维护成本,Laravel在这方面做得很好。
from flask import redirect, url_for @app.route('/login', methods=['POST']) def login_post(): # ... 验证用户 ... if user_authenticated: return redirect(url_for('user_dashboard', user_id=current_user.id)) else: return "登录失败" API响应中的链接: 在构建RESTful API时,有时需要在JSON响应中包含指向相关资源的链接(HATEOAS原则)。
games.Sprite类: 游戏中的基本可视对象,拥有位置(x, y)、尺寸(width, height)以及移动速度(dx用于水平速度,dy用于垂直速度)等属性。
集成OAuth2或身份中心服务 大型系统通常会部署独立的认证中心(如使用Keycloak、Auth0或自研),所有服务将鉴权请求转发给该中心。
例如,想把 int 数组设为 1,用 memset(arr, 1, sizeof(arr)) 是错误的——每个字节被设为1,导致每个 int 变成 0x01010101(不等于1) 适合初始化为 0、-1 这类在所有字节上具有相同值的数 对浮点数数组无效,不能用 memset 设置 float 为 0.0 以外的值(即使0.0也建议用循环或 fill) 慎用于类对象或包含指针的结构体,可能导致资源管理问题 sizeof 使用要准确,避免只传数组指针导致只设置前几个字节 替代方案推荐 对于更安全和通用的初始化,建议: 使用 std::fill:支持任意值,类型安全 std::fill(arr, arr + 10, 5); // 所有元素设为5使用 for 循环或范围赋值,尤其适合复杂类型 构造时直接初始化:int arr[10] = {}; 清零 基本上就这些。
选择哪种方式取决于你的使用场景:XSLT适合标准转换,Python适合定制逻辑,正则适合快速小修,命令行工具适合自动化运维。
本文链接:http://www.roselinjean.com/20967_7716a8.html